The STM32F767VIT6 is a high-performance microcontroller (MCU) from STMicroelectronics' STM32 family, specifically designed for a wide range of applications that require advanced processing capabilities, high memory density, and connectivity options. It belongs to the STM32F7 series, which is based on the ARM Cortex-M7 processor.

Applications:
The STM32F767VIT6 is suitable for a wide range of applications that require advanced processing capabilities, high memory density, and connectivity options. Some of the potential applications include:
- Industrial automation and control systems
- Medical equipment and devices
- Robotics and drones
- High-end consumer electronics
- IoT gateways and smart devices
- Automotive infotainment systems
- Networking and communication devices
- Advanced human-machine interface (HMI) systems
- Audio and video processing applications
- Embedded systems requiring high computational performance and advanced graphics capabilities
The STM32F767VIT6's combination of processing power, memory, and connectivity options make it a versatile and powerful MCU for a variety of high-end applications.
